How to Use This Journal +
Getting started is simple. Set aside 10–15 minutes each morning or evening — a consistent time works best. Open to today’s date and begin with the Bible Reading Plan section: read the assigned passage, then write one verse that stood out to you and why. Next, move to the Prayer List and record your requests by name. Be specific — specific prayers produce specific praise reports. In the Heart of Service section, note one way you served or could serve someone this week. The Grateful Heart section is your daily gratitude record; even on hard days, write at least three things. Use the Personal Evaluation section at the end of each week to reflect honestly: Where did you grow? Where did you struggle? Finally, the Thought Section is your free-writing space — sermon notes, scripture meditations, or anything the Lord lays on your heart. After one full year, the two-year side-by-side format lets you read last year’s entry alongside this year’s — and see, in your own handwriting, exactly how God has moved.
Journal Prompts for Women +
Sometimes the hardest part of journaling is knowing where to begin. These King James-rooted gratitude prompts and reflection questions are designed specifically for women who want to go deeper in their walk with God:
- What is one thing the Lord has been teaching me this week, and how have I responded?
- Which King James scripture has stayed with me lately, and what does it mean for my life right now?
- Where have I seen God’s faithfulness in a situation I was worried about?
- Is there someone in my life I need to pray for more intentionally? What do I believe God wants to do in their life?
- What does “serving others” look like for me this week — at home, at church, or in my community?
- What am I grateful for today that I have never written down before?
- Where have I struggled to trust God recently, and what scripture speaks to that struggle?
- How has my prayer life changed over the past month? What do I want it to look like a year from now?
